  1. Participation

3.1 Participation in Springboard Art Fair 2023 is only possible upon invitation by the Organizer and after review of the Entrant’s application leading to the formation of a participation agreement.

3.2 The Entrant must in any case meet the following professional criteria:

– Has graduated from a recognized Dutch art academy or postgraduate institution during the period September 1, 2018 and December 31, 2021. Or has Dutch nationality and graduated from a recognized foreign art academy or post-academic institution during the period September 1, 2018 and December 31, 2021

– Is a professional artist, designer or designer.

– Shows work no older than 5 years.

  1. Fees, coaching and stand construction.

9.1 Participation in Springboard Art Fair is free of charge to Participant.

9.2 Participant receives an expense allowance of € 200,- excluding VAT (if VAT is applicable).

9.3 Participant will be assigned an art professional as coach. The coach has a non-committal advisory role. In connection with the limited possible time investment of the coach, the participant must deal reasonably with the expected commitment of the coach. As an indication, the coach has a total of 25 hours to devote to the coaching of 5 artists.

9.4 Participant needs to make a stand layout in consultation with coach and 4 fellow artists and coach. Frameworks for this will be provided by the fair in cooperation with Tom Postma Design.
